Classification of the Scam
Users have highlighted that the scam typically involves claims of subscription renewals or charges for security software, particularly associated with McAfee. The emails received are crafted to incite fear, suggesting that failure to act will lead to automatic deductions from bank accounts. Such tactics are indicators of a phishing scam where scammers aim to trick individuals into revealing sensitive information.
What to Do If You Receive a Call from 02 8003 3136
If you receive a call from this number, here are key actions to consider:
- Do Not Answer: If you recognise the number, it's best to ignore the call.
- Report the Number: Use platforms like Reverseau to report the number and warn others.
- Delete Related Emails: If you've received any suspicious emails alleging payments, delete them immediately.
- Protect Your Information: Never provide personal or financial information over the phone if you did not initiate the call.
